2.🧪What is this thing

It’s a “concentrated brightening serum” that costs $500 for 1.3 oz. The brand claims it targets dullness and uneven texture at the cellular level.

3.📸Ingredients that matter

Don’t let the fancy bottle fool you — the formula is legit. The hero is their proprietary “Skin-Empowering Illuminator” plus some heavy hitters you’d actually recognize.

  • Plankton extract: Boosts skin’s natural moisture barrier
  • Hydrolyzed silk: Makes it feel like liquid velvet
  • Theanine: Calms redness better than most soothing serums
  • Tocopherol: Vitamin E that actually penetrates
4.📊30 days of truth

Day 1: Texture is like liquid silk — thinner than I expected, almost watery. Sinks in before I could blink. Day 7: Skin looked… rested? Like I actually slept 8 hours. Day 14: That’s when things got real. My pores looked smaller. Not dramatically, but enough that I noticed in my car mirror.

Week 3-4: The glow is real. But here’s the thing nobody tells you — if you stop using it, your skin goes back to normal within a week. There’s no memory effect.

💡

One Thing: Apply to damp skin — not dry. Two pumps on wet face halves the product you need. Trust me on this.
5.💡Verdict time

My skin looked better. Brighter. Smoother. But it didn’t change my life. My acne scars stayed the same. My dark circles didn’t vanish.

Buy if
You have dry, dull skin and $500 is a Tuesday expense for you
⏭️

Skip if
You’re targeting acne scars or deep wrinkles — this won’t touch them
💰

Worth it?
Only if you can afford to repurchase monthly. It’s a luxury habit, not a solution.
